
Fans of the Toronto Raptors were left dumbfounded on Monday night.
Their team was playing quite well and seemed on its way to securing one of their best wins of the season against the Denver Nuggets.
But in the final minutes of the game, former Rookie of the Year Scottie Barnes was ejected as the team was fighting to take the lead.
Following the ejection, Barnes opened up about being kicked out by referee Scott Foster, saying, “I was just saying something to myself. I guess he took offense to it so they just threw me out of the game.”

This was Barnes’ first career ejection and it was shocking, to say the least.
It’s still not clear what exactly Barnes said that raised the ire of Foster but he was quickly kicked out of the game, which gave the Nuggets an opening to build on their lead.
They eventually took home a 118-113 victory.
For his part, Foster said that Barnes was ejected because he “directly questioned the integrity of the crew.”
Referees are very particular about what players can and can’t say and their ruling is final.
It was surprising to see Barnes kicked out because this was his first ejection and also because he didn’t seem too animated or angry on the court.
But apparently, he was saying enough to catch the ear of Foster.
The Raptors were hoping to win on Monday as they are the ninth team in their conference with a 32-34 record.
Every single win at this point counts and a victory over the Nuggets would have been momentous for them.
Instead, the game ended in a defeat and one of the most controversial calls of the season.
